
French President Emmanuel Macron, during the conference with Prime Minister Edi Rama, also spoke about a plan for Albania and the region, where he promises to lead a new political process that will be called 'Reunification of Europe', which aims to strengthen the economies of the Balkans and cooperation with the EU.
The analyst Frrok Çupi also spoke about this initiative, as he said in "Special Report" that through this statement, Macron conveyed two messages.
According to him, one has to do with the time when he chose to make the official visit to Albania related to the Berlin Process Summit that was held on Monday in Tirana.
"There were two messages. The first and very important is that Macron's move seems genius. It has chosen the time to come within the Berlin process together with Europe but with a slightly different agenda. The reunification of Europe means removing the lines that were established after '45 in the Second World War and secondly reuniting the values of Europe because it must and is on the way to the displacement of its axis. The axis of Europe was not simply between Germany and France but it is all the way to Moldova.
This is the most gigantic idea that is placed on the tables of Europe after the Second World War. They are well known, I have read the Open Balkans as an initiative of the US and partly of the EU precisely to relocate the axis of Europe, to bring it to the place where it was. We are now in the Berlin process, which has great value. And the second message, is that Macron said a very interesting thing that democratic accidents can bring one thing, that if we set rules, they will use the rules. The government in Kosovo is a democratic accident", stressed the analyst.
